HRIS Payroll Specialist – City of Overland Park

HRIS/Payroll Specialist
Job ID #46

The City of Overland Park has an HRIS/Payroll Specialist position available in the Human Resources Department. The successful candidate must have strong written and verbal communication skills, must be a team player, and have the ability to work in a fast-paced environment.

Responsibilities

Functional lead in all human resources information system
(HRIS) related issues. Coordinates, oversees and implements special projects for the human resources information system (HRIS). Analyzes business processes, identifies alternatives, assesses costs vs. benefits, recommends and implements appropriate solutions. Acts as the
functional specialist in numerous HR areas to include payroll, FMLA, budget and finance. Act as the HRIS training administrator. Responsible for processing a minimum of four payrolls during the year, as well as processing payroll in the absence of the payroll coordinator. Responsible for overseeing HRIS security. Develop and administer train-the-trainer program for HRIS end user and self-service applications.

Requirements

  • Bachelor’s degree in business administration, personnel management, or a related field of study; or an equivalent combination of work experience and formal education.
  • Five years experience in HRIS/payroll systems with a focus on HRIS applications.
  • Must also be familiar in developing ad hoc reports using a report writer and query tools. Must have entry-level programming experience in Query/SQL.
  • Five years working knowledge of complex automated payroll system and accounting and record-keeping experience, and two years experience with state and federal tax reporting procedures, or equivalent levels of experience.

No City residency requirement. Must successfully pass a background check, drug screen, and physical. 8:00 a.m.-5:00 p.m., Mon.-Fri. $4,555-$5,694/month. Open until filled.
